In surfing, as in most physical endeavours, the boundaries of performance creep, rather than rush, forward. Just as Olympic world records are ticked off by mere hundredths of a second, so too are the criteria for surfing - higher, faster, deeper - broken in increments.
The exception to this rule occurred over the course of one hour in January 1990.
